The Conversion Factor: Centimeters to Inches



The fundamental relationship between centimeters and inches is defined by the conversion factor: 1 inch is approximately equal to 2.54 centimeters. This means that for every inch, there are 2.54 centimeters. To convert centimeters to inches, we essentially reverse this process, dividing the number of centimeters by 2.54.

Calculating 27 Centimeters to Inches: A Step-by-Step Approach



Now, let's apply this knowledge to convert 27 centimeters to inches:

1. Identify the conversion factor: 1 inch ≈ 2.54 centimeters

2. Set up the equation: Inches = Centimeters / 2.54

3. Substitute the value: Inches = 27 cm / 2.54 cm/inch

4. Calculate the result: Inches ≈ 10.63 inches

Therefore, 27 centimeters is approximately equal to 10.63 inches. It's important to note that we use "approximately equal to" (≈) because the conversion factor is an approximation. The actual conversion is slightly more complex, involving more decimal places, but 10.63 inches provides sufficient accuracy for most practical applications.

Real-World Applications: Examples of 27 Centimeter Measurements



Let's consider some real-world examples where understanding this conversion is vital:

Clothing sizes: If you order clothing online from a website that uses centimeters, and you find a shirt with a sleeve length of 27 cm, knowing that this equates to approximately 10.63 inches will help you assess whether it will fit your arm length comfortably.

Electronics: The screen size of a tablet or a laptop might be specified in centimeters. Knowing that a 27 cm diagonal screen translates to about 10.63 inches can help you compare it with similar devices specified in inches.

DIY Projects: If you're following a DIY project plan that uses both metric and imperial units, converting 27 centimeters (say, the length of a board) to 10.63 inches will ensure accurate measurements throughout your project.

Medical Measurements: In medical contexts, precise measurements are paramount. A child's arm circumference, measured in centimeters, might need to be converted to inches for comparison with standard growth charts using the imperial system.
